    I went to Lutheran Church of Our Savior last Sunday. The service was a traditional Christain…read moreservice, which I enjoyed - no TV viewing or loud band. I was handed a pamphlet with the church information, service agenda, bible's readings, etc when I arrived. One of my favorite part of the service, was when the pastor, Rev. Scott Klemsz, asked the children to sit in front of the alter area and discuss the reading of the day. Kids can come up with most interesting unique questions and Rev Scott answered them all; in a way, that they can understand. During Communion, there is a choice to drink the sacramental wine from the communion goblet or individual cups. The members of the church were very nice to me. A couple of the members introduced themselves and invited me for coffee and treats after the service. I felt welcome. If you are looking for a Lutheran Church or want to open your spirit to something new and/or traditional, Lutheran Church of Our Savior is a good place to go to.
